Output fa31ec5b87a76a4b321f56d61e919a815aeb2c5ff65b0a5f9f63e4a46a2a2484:0

value
594110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b4ca4baa8a3af22b6b92e94ce044285f921149b OP_EQUAL
address
3LDxumT8TDYe5mA46m76NTo9K3JoJD1bxD
transaction
fa31ec5b87a76a4b321f56d61e919a815aeb2c5ff65b0a5f9f63e4a46a2a2484
spent
true